The global medical document management systems market size is likely to be valued at US$ 1.51 Bn in 2025 and is estimated to reach US$ 3.2 Bn by 2032, growing at a robust CAGR of 11.33% during the forecast period from 2025 to 2032. As healthcare digitization accelerates globally, the need for efficient management of electronic health records (EHR), billing data, patient files, and compliance documents is growing rapidly. This surge in digital documentation is creating a favorable environment for the expansion of medical document management systems (MDMS).
Medical Document Management Systems Market - Report Scope
The medical document management systems market encompasses software and services that facilitate the organization, storage, retrieval, and sharing of patient and operational documents across healthcare settings. These systems reduce paperwork, improve workflow efficiency, and help ensure compliance with health information privacy regulations like HIPAA. MDMS plays a pivotal role in transforming legacy document management into streamlined digital processes for hospitals, clinics, and other care providers.
Key Market Growth Drivers
The global medical document management systems market is being primarily driven by the increasing demand for digital health solutions across healthcare institutions. The push toward electronic medical records (EMR), growing adoption of cloud-based healthcare IT systems, and stringent regulatory requirements for patient data management are key contributors to market growth. Additionally, the rising volume of healthcare data and the need to eliminate errors associated with manual documentation processes are prompting organizations to adopt automated document management solutions. Furthermore, favorable government initiatives supporting healthcare IT infrastructure are strengthening market development.
Market Restraints
Despite the strong growth trajectory, the market faces challenges such as high implementation and maintenance costs, especially for small to mid-sized healthcare providers. Resistance to change from traditional paper-based workflows and the complexity of migrating legacy data can hinder adoption. Moreover, concerns surrounding data privacy, cybersecurity risks, and interoperability issues between systems from different vendors continue to limit the widespread integration of MDMS across the healthcare ecosystem.
Market Opportunities
The ongoing digital transformation in emerging economies presents immense opportunities for MDMS providers. The expansion of telemedicine, mobile health (mHealth) platforms, and integrated health record systems will further boost the demand for robust document management infrastructure. Additionally, the proliferation of cloud-based solutions enables remote access and scalable deployment, offering cost-effective benefits to smaller institutions. Strategic collaborations between software developers and healthcare facilities can lead to the development of AI-driven, interoperable, and intuitive systems tailored to specific healthcare needs.
Regional Outlook
North America dominates the global medical document management systems market owing to its advanced healthcare IT infrastructure, regulatory mandates for EHR implementation, and significant investments by hospitals in digitization. Europe follows closely, driven by stringent data governance policies and increasing public-private partnerships in healthcare digitization. Asia Pacific is expected to exhibit the fastest growth, attributed to rising healthcare expenditure, the growing burden of chronic diseases, and the adoption of telehealth and digital record-keeping in countries like India, China, and Japan. Latin America and the Middle East & Africa also show promising potential due to government-backed healthcare modernization programs.
